Categorie

programmazione di giochi da casinò

Quale linguaggio di programmazione viene utilizzato per i giochi da casinò?

Dietro ogni giro della ruota della roulette, ogni giro di una carta nel blackjack e ogni display colorato su una slot machine, c’è un sofisticato mix di programmazione e tecnologia. L’industria dei casinò online, del valore di miliardi di dollari, dipende dalla complessa codifica creata da sviluppatori di software dedicati. Ma quale linguaggio di programmazione usano i casinò online come il casinò 69Games per creare giochi così entusiasmanti?

La risposta a questo non è semplice. Giochi diversi potrebbero richiedere lingue diverse e la scelta della lingua potrebbe essere influenzata da fattori quali la piattaforma (web o mobile), la complessità del gioco e la competenza dello sviluppatore. Qui esploreremo le principali lingue che alimentano il vibrante mondo dei giochi da casinò online.

HTML5 – La lingua franca dei giochi da casinò basati sul web

HTML5 non è solo un linguaggio di programmazione; è il futuro del gioco online. Con la sua capacità di creare design reattivi adatti a qualsiasi dispositivo o dimensione dello schermo, HTML5 è diventato il linguaggio di riferimento per i giochi da casinò basati sul web. Consente agli sviluppatori di creare giochi che funzionano senza problemi su desktop, smartphone e tablet.

Inoltre, HTML5 supporta elementi multimediali come audio e video senza la necessità di plug-in aggiuntivi. Ciò significa che gli sviluppatori possono creare giochi più interattivi e coinvolgenti con esperienze audiovisive superiori. Infine, i giochi HTML5 vengono caricati direttamente nel browser Web, rendendoli facilmente accessibili ai giocatori e offrendo un’esperienza di gioco senza interruzioni.

Java e Flash: la vecchia guardia del gioco online

Sebbene l’HTML5 sia sempre più popolare, anche i linguaggi meno recenti come Java e Flash hanno svolto un ruolo significativo nello sviluppo dei giochi da casinò online. Java, con il suo principio “scrivi una volta, esegui ovunque”, è stato a lungo uno dei preferiti per la creazione di giochi indipendenti dalla piattaforma. La sua robustezza e versatilità lo rendono un’ottima scelta per giochi complessi come il poker o il blackjack, che richiedono una logica di gioco complessa.

Flash, d’altra parte, è da anni la spina dorsale dei giochi online. La sua capacità di fornire ricchi contenuti multimediali lo rendeva ideale per lo sviluppo di giochi interattivi. Tuttavia, poiché Flash non è più supportato da molti browser e viene gradualmente eliminato, il suo predominio nel settore dei giochi online è diminuito.

C++ e Unity – Creazione di giochi da casinò avanzati

Per giochi da casinò più complessi e graficamente impegnativi, entrano in gioco linguaggi come C++. C++ fornisce un alto livello di controllo sulle risorse di sistema ed è eccellente per creare giochi in cui le prestazioni sono un fattore critico. Questo linguaggio viene spesso utilizzato per i giochi da casinò scaricabili che offrono una grafica di alta qualità e un’esperienza di gioco stabile.

Inoltre, piattaforme di sviluppo di giochi come Unity, che utilizza principalmente C#, hanno visto un uso crescente nella creazione di giochi da casinò. Unity offre una serie di strumenti e funzionalità che semplificano il processo di sviluppo del gioco, rendendolo una scelta interessante per gli sviluppatori.

Il mondo multilingue dei giochi da casinò

Il regno dei giochi da casinò online è tanto vario nell’uso dei linguaggi di programmazione quanto nella varietà di giochi che offre. Dalla versatilità di HTML5 nella creazione di giochi reattivi basati sul Web, la robustezza di Java per la logica di gioco complessa, all’idoneità di C++ e Unity per i giochi avanzati, la scelta del linguaggio dipende in ultima analisi dai requisiti del gioco e dall’esperienza dello sviluppatore. Una cosa è certa, però: ogni riga di codice ci avvicina di un passo a quell’entusiasmante jackpot.